FDA Product Code QJF: Autofluorescence Imaging Adjunct Tool For Wounds
An Autofluorescence Detection Device For General Surgery And Dermatological Use Is An Adjunct Tool That Uses Autofluorescence To Detect Tissues Or Structures. This Device Is Not Intended To Provide A Diagnosis.
Leading manufacturers include Moleculight, Inc., Precision Healing, LLC and Kent Imaging, Inc..

510(k) Submission Activity
7 total 510(k) submissions under product code QJF since 2019, with 7 receiving FDA clearance (average review time: 173 days).
Submission volume has increased in recent years - 2 submissions in the last 24 months compared to 1 in the prior period - suggesting growing market activity in this device classification.
FDA Review Time
Recent submissions under QJF have taken an average of 236 days to reach a decision - up from 148 days historically. Manufacturers should account for longer review timelines in current project planning.
